Housing development redesigned from 4 detached to 10 semi-detached homes

Refused by council on 16 April 2026, now appealed

Braddingford Construction wants to change a housing development at Corskeagh, Frenchpark. Instead of 4 single-storey detached houses, they're now proposing 10 semi-detached houses with three bedrooms spread over two storeys. The council refused permission, but the decision has been appealed.
